A gas explosion blew up an apartment in a building in Vénissieux, a suburb of Lyon, killing one person.
The Minguettes district of Vénissieux, near Lyon, was awakened last Sunday night by a powerful explosion at around 3:30 a.m., reports TF1. A gas leak blew up a third-floor apartment in a seven-story apartment building, before large flames appeared.
The 80 firefighters who arrived quickly on the scene brought the fire under control, which left a heavy toll, for the moment provisional: one person died in the destroyed apartment and around fifteen people were injured from smoke inhalation.
Alternative housing solutions will have to be found and the apartment's guardrail, blown away in the explosion and hanging in the void outside the building, will have to be secured.
